The rovibrational spectrum of the He-N2O van der Waals complex has been recorded in the N2O-monomer nu(1) region (similar to 1285 cm(-1)) using an infrared tunable diode laser spectrometer in conjunction with a free supersonic jet expansion and an astigmatic multi-pass absorption cell. Twenty-two lines are assigned to the nu(2)-band of He-N2O. Rotational constants for the nu(2)-excited state are derived.
